67 idler arm was a poor design. Of course this was more of a factor when the cars were driven on ice/snow. Slide into a curb with either front wheel and the single tang on the K would bend changing the toe setting. For 68 up the engineers fixed that with a two tang bracket on the K and a through bolt attaching the arm.
If you have means to change that bracket, that is your best move. Doesn't necessarily have to be slippery roads to bang a curb.
The more common idler arm is less expensive too.
